@Arniebear...... he has Nero and Roxio, both, on his computer...... they conflict. use one or the other. here is Roxio Zapper:

http://www.softpedia.com/get/Tweak/Uninstallers/Roxio-Zap.shtml

uninstall Roxio and then use the zapper on it to remove any trace of Roxio in your computer. If you deside to keep Roxio take out Nero.... here is Nero cleaning tools.... do the same thing.... uninstall then use the cleaning tools:

for Nero 6:

http://ww2.nero.com/nero6/en/Clean_Tools.html

for Nero 7:

http://ww2.nero.com/nero7/enu/Nero7_CleanTool.html

seems like your disk didn't finalize. try it now after you take out Nero or Roxio. Remember..... they conflict and untill you just use one it makes the burning software buggy.
